Lindsay Alyse Leonard ’08

A picture of Lindsay Leonard

Lindsay Alyse Leonard ’08. November 1, 2009, in Portland. Lindsay was a psychology major who wrote her thesis on therapies for Hepatitis C. Just a few months after commencement, Lindsay and her roommate, Jessica Finlay ’09, were walking across Southeast Foster Road near 82nd Avenue in a marked crosswalk when they were struck by a car. Lindsay was killed; Jessica sustained multiple life-threatening injuries. People who saw the crash said a bus in the right lane had stopped to let the two cross, but it appears the driver of the car in the left lane did not see the pedestrians until it was too late. A statement from the family read: “Lindsay was our beloved daughter, sister, aunt, and friend. She was a dynamic young woman with a bright future ahead of her. Lindsay was a travel enthusiast, Magic Castle member, stellar student at Webb High School, and recent Reed College graduate. She had hopes of furthering her education to become a nurse practitioner or doctor. She wanted to explore the use of herbal medicines in her pursuit to help others. She was a ray of sunshine in all of our lives, and we are devastated by our loss.” A memorial service for Lindsay was held in the chapel in Eliot Hall.
